N-.tic is her by ;ien that at the
s.-hool district bond election hereby
ralh-d to he held at High School .As--senioly.
corner of Jacktoa St. a ad
l.une St., Ko.-'diuTK. 4Jrt-Kon, in und
tor School Di-'iriit No. 4, of Douglas
County, (ifKuii. Saturday, the 11th
nay of .Var.-h, A. D IHIO, between
H.e hours 01 two o'clock p. 111. and
-- ti o lock p. m., there will-be
-ill-mil icd 10 liie b ir.il voters thereof
'be iji;. siion of contractinK a bonded
imlebf lilies in the sum of T.",uuu.
'u fur the impose of trectinR and
: urn mi a K'kIi School Huild.ii?
md iurchaHiii any ne essary addi
tional irou ml in and lor said school
di.-trict. The vote to he by ballot,
i! pon which shall he the words
"liondv - V V and "Bonds No;"
and tlo oter shall place a cross
1X1 b "twe-n the word "Homls" and
the word "V's." or between tho word
' lii.nd!' mi l the word "So," which
indicates his choice. The polls for
the reception of the. ballots cast for
or against the contraction of said in-
Jebndnesu will, on said day and date
and at tin' place aforesaid, be opened
at the hour of two o'clock p. in. and
remain open until the hour of seven
o'clock p. m. oi the same day when
the sauif1 ! hall lw dosed.
